Description

Each vol. has added engraved title-page, engraved with the imprint "Bruxelles, Le Francq, 1785", and is dated 1785 on the spine.


Tome 2 is the 4. ed. publ. 1777.


Pagination slightly irregular. Pages 417-18 of volume 5 are bound in error following p.416.


Edited by E. A. Philippe de Prétot.


Partial contents: 1. La boucle de cheveux enlevée: poeme heroï-comique de Monsieur Pope: traduit de l'anglois par Mr. ** [P. F. Guyot Desfontaines] -- 2. I: Catherine de France, reine d'Angleterre, par Mr. Boudot de Juilli. Quatrième edition -- 4. V: Mémoires du Conte de Gramont, par Antoine Hamilton -- 5. I: Suite des Mémoires du Conte de Gramont -- 6. III: Le bélier, conte, par Antoine comte d'Hamilton -- 7. I: Les quatre Facardins, conte, par le Comte Antoine Hamilton.
